Job Overview:
As a Process Engineer you will drive operational excellence and continuous improvement in manufacturing. You'll identify and eliminate process losses, enhance quality, and leverage digital tools to optimize production. Ideal for analytical minds passionate about making an immediate impact on efficiency and technical capabilities.
Key Responsibilities:
- Process Optimization: Identify, prioritize, and eliminate process losses to build capability and control.
- Continuous Improvement: Lead RE analysis, touch mapping, and weekly Hoshin cycles to streamline processes and reduce manual intervention.
- Operational Standards: Ensure proper HS&E and Quality foundations; manage the line's RTT DMS and coach IWS progress.
- Data & Digital Tools: Utilize Databricks, SQL, KNIME, Tableau, Power BI, JMP/SPSS (or similar) for data analysis and visualization.
- Digital Transformation: Support and lead adoption of digital solutions, facilitating integration and team training for efficiency.
- Value Creation: Participate in loss analyses, collaborate with stakeholders, and engage cross-functional teams to deliver business results.
